^^ Yep that is the signature Honda whistle. My B16A did the same exact thing. Its kinda funny because if you shift just right it sounds like a mini blow off, lol, I have had people ask if it was turbo because of that noise. One other thing worth mentioning is that I have heard aftermarket clutches (ACT in this case) that made a very similar sound when being slipped.

Makes sense that it is probably the throttle body. I've had two S2000's and both have made the same whistling/ringing sound under light throttle at about 3000-3200 RPM. I also heard the same noise on my '87, '89 Civics and '96 Prelude but not on my wife's '04 CR-V.
